NBA Baller Amar’e Stoudemire Secretly Weds Alexis Welch on 12-12-12
NBA Baller Amar’e Stoudemire and his fiance Alexis Welch made their love ‘official’. The couple used 12-12-12 to tie the knot secretly, on the roof deck of their apartment. Showing off their bling on twitter, Amar’e wrote:
12.12.12 now has a special & spiritual meaning for us…
According to reports, the ceremony was very intimate, with only 12 guests (get, 12-12-12?), including their three children and family. Now what these two wear on their special day? Alexis rocked a long, slim-fitting, custom-made wedding dress with no train, while Amar’e wore a Calvin Klein suit, with his wedding ring designed by Shayan Afshar (who also designed Alexis’ ring).
An insider tells NYPost,
“They decided to do this because of the date, and they wanted to do something spiritual and private for themselves.”
After jumping the broom, the two hit up the “12-12-12” concert at Madison Square Garden. Reportedly, the couple plan to have a bigger, tricked-out-wedding (my words, not theirs) this summer.
